Chiniot
Chiniot, nestled along the Chenab River in Punjab, Pakistan, is a city that seamlessly blends rich history with vibrant craftsmanship. Known for its exquisite woodwork, historic architecture, and tranquil river views, Chiniot offers travelers an authentic glimpse into Punjab's cultural soul. Ideal for history enthusiasts, art lovers, and those seeking a peaceful retreat, a 2-3 day visit allows for a comprehensive exploration of its treasures.
Travel Tips in Chiniot
Best Time to Visit
The optimal time to visit Chiniot is during the cooler months, from October to March, when temperatures are more comfortable for outdoor activities. Be prepared for hazy conditions and varying air quality during this period.
How to Get There and Get Around
Chiniot is accessible via major cities:
-
By Road: From Lahore, take the M2 Motorway to Pindi Bhattian, then the M4 Motorway to Chiniot. The journey is approximately 160 km and takes about 3.5–4 hours. (travel-culture.com)
-
By Train: Chiniot is connected to major cities through railway lines, with comfortable trains linking it to Faisalabad, Lahore, and Karachi. (chiniotcity.com.pk)
Within the city, taxis and rickshaws are available for local travel.
Safety
Chiniot is generally safe for travelers. However, it's advisable to stay alert, especially during late hours. Solo female travelers should dress modestly and avoid traveling alone at night. (travelladies.app)
Local Customs, Language, Etiquette
The primary language spoken is Punjabi, with Urdu also widely understood. Dress modestly to respect local customs. Engaging with locals in markets and workshops is encouraged; they are known for their hospitality.

Highlights & Things to Do in Chiniot
1. Shahi Mosque
Built between 1646 and 1655, this 17th-century mosque is renowned for its intricate stonework and historical significance. (en.wikipedia.org)
2. Omar Hayat Mahal
Also known as Gulzar Manzil, this early 20th-century wooden mansion showcases exceptional Chinioti woodwork and architecture. (en.wikipedia.org)
3. Chinioti Furniture Workshops
Explore local workshops to witness artisans crafting intricate wooden furniture, a tradition that dates back to the Mughal era. (globosapiens.net)
4. Chenab River Banks
Enjoy a leisurely stroll along the river, offering picturesque views and a serene atmosphere. (travel-culture.com)
5. Traditional Bazaars
Wander through bustling markets to find handcrafted goods, textiles, and local delicacies. (travel-culture.com)
6. Tazias of Chiniot
Witness the artistic craftsmanship of Tazias, symbolic structures used during Muharram processions. (travel-culture.com)
7. Rural Villages
Visit nearby villages to experience traditional Punjabi rural life, with opportunities to interact with locals and see traditional mud homes. (travel-culture.com)
